Gutter Maintenance in Bergen County, NJ

Gutter maintenance services involve inspecting, cleaning, and repairing the gutter systems on residential properties to ensure proper water flow and prevent damage. These projects typically include removing debris such as leaves and twigs, checking for clogs or leaks, and making necessary repairs to gutters, downspouts, and related components. Homeowners often seek this service to protect their roofs, foundations, and landscaping from water-related issues, especially after storms or seasons with heavy leaf fall.

Before requesting gutter maintenance,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the service includes thorough cleaning, minor repairs, or system upgrades. It’s also helpful to know if the service can accommodate specific concerns like overflowing gutters, sagging sections, or damaged hardware. Clear communication about the condition of the existing gutter system and any particular issues can ensure the maintenance process addresses all necessary repairs and keeps the property protected.

Project Types

Common Gutter Maintenance Jobs

Gutter Cleaning - removing leaves, debris, and buildup to ensure proper water flow.

Gutter Inspection - checking for damage, leaks, and blockages to prevent water damage.

Gutter Repair - fixing leaks, loose brackets, and damaged sections for optimal performance.

Gutter Replacement - installing new gutters to improve drainage and protect the property.

Gutter Guard Installation - adding screens or covers to reduce debris accumulation.

Downspout Maintenance - clearing and repairing downspouts for effective water diversion.

Gutter Maintenance Questions

Why is regular gutter maintenance important? Regular maintenance helps prevent clogs, water damage, and foundation issues by ensuring proper water flow away from the property.

What does gutter maintenance typically include? It usually involves cleaning out debris, inspecting for damage, and ensuring downspouts are clear and functioning properly.

How often should gutters be maintained? Gutter maintenance is recommended at least twice a year, especially after heavy storms or during the fall season.

What are common signs that gutters need attention? Signs include overflowing water, sagging gutters, visible debris buildup, or water pooling near the foundation.
